About this place
Pisa's second most important piazza, built on the site of the ancient Roman Forum and a hub of medieval power. Giorgio Vasari redesigned it in 1558 at the behest of Cosimo I de' Medici. The square features the Palazzo della Carovana, the Chiesa di Santo Stefano dei Cavalieri, the Palazzo dell'Orologio, and a statue of Cosimo I. What to see here includes fine Renaissance architecture and fascinating layers of Pisan history from Roman times through the medieval period.
